Love Grandma by Ann Morris is a short and sweet children's book that tells us the story of a grandma and her two little girls, with whom she loved to play.

The book begins with the birth of Payton, grandma's first grandchild. She loved Payton with all her heart, and just after some time came Haley in their life. There was an unbreakable love between both the sisters, and grandma loved them both equally. They used to play games, bake cookies, draw on the driveway, and many more things. Learn all about it in this very wholesome book written by Ann Morris.

The thing that I really liked in this book is how sweet it is. At some points while reading it, I laughed to myself, and there was always a smile on my face. The book is in a rhyming pattern so that the flow of the reader is maintained throughout the book, and it makes it easy for little children to read and enjoy this book as well. There are colored pictures in the book that displayed the activities grandma did with her granddaughters, this can help children imagine the scenes talked about in the book, and it makes the book more interesting.

The language used in it is pretty simple and easy to understand. Children who are in elementary school will really enjoy it, and parents who want a book to read to their children can also pick this one. It will add love to both parents and children's life. There was no use of any kind of profane or vulgar language, as it's a children's book, and I didn't find any grammatical mistakes or typos in it. So I can say there is nothing that I did not like about this book.

At the end, I would like to rate this book 4 out of 4 stars, as it was really fun to read, and I wouldn't mind reading it to my little brother. I would recommend it to parents who want to teach their children about the love between grandparents and children. Kids who have started to read will also find this book pretty enjoyable.
